Hello, 

I create Data connection to oracle using DSN, the configurations of the DSN:
        
Data Source Name = MGDATA
TNS service Name = OSSCSATR
User ID = MGDATA

When I open the connection I see only tables of MGDATA schema.
If I change the User ID to GIS in the DSN I see only tables of GIS 

I use on this two case the same user and password to log on the database.

What I need to do to see all schemes of my database using my user?
